LAKELAND, Fla.—Southeastern played host to its first beach volleyball tri-match in program history, welcoming Warner and Webber International to the courts at HP Sports.
The Fire won the first contest against Warner 4-1 and lost the second by the same score.
Southeastern (3-4) avenged an early season loss to Warner by winning the first three matches of the day.
Holly Kaczmarek and
Emilia Harding were straight-sets winners at Flight 5 with
Emily Eurice and
Chloe Rhodes taking Flight 4 21-14, 21-13. A win by
Kennedy Jones and
Ryanne VanWyk at Flight 3 clinched the match in three sets, winning the third 23-21.
Alexandra Postlethwaite and
Grace Petty won in three sets at the top flight.
Against Webber International, the Fire scored first in a tight match at Flight 5 with Kaczmarek and Harding winning 26-24, 24-22. Three of the other four matches went to the Warriors in straight sets with Jones and VanWyk going to a third set after taking the first 21-18.
